Species Vibrio rhizosphaerae

Name: Vibrio rhizosphaerae Ramesh Kumar and Nair 2007

Category: Species

Proposed as: sp. nov.

Etymology: rhi.zo.sphae’rae. Gr. fem. n. rhiza, root; Gr. fem. n. sphaîra (gen. sphaîras), ball, any globe, sphere; N.L. gen. fem. n. rhizosphaerae, of the rhizosphere

Gender: masculine

Type strain: DSM 18581; LMG 23790; MSSRF3

16S rRNA gene: DQ847123 Analyse FASTA

Valid publication: Kumar NR, Nair S. Vibrio rhizosphaerae sp. nov., a red-pigmented bacterium that antagonizes phytopathogenic bacteria. Int J Syst Evol Microbiol 2007; 57:2241-2246.

IJSEM list: Euzeby JP. Notification list. Notification that new names and new combinations have appeared in volume 57, part 10 of the IJSEM. Int J Syst Evol Microbiol 2008; 58:3-4.

Nomenclatural status: validly published under the ICNP

Taxonomic status: correct name

Risk group: 1

Parent taxon: Vibrio Pacini 1854 (Approved Lists 1980)
